The global soccer governing body is set to increase the size of the 2026 tournament in North America by creating a bigger group stage for the 48 teams with a 104-game schedule.
The new program -- still expected to consist of four teams per group -- will last
approximately six weeks between June and July between 16 cities in the U.S., Canada and Mexico.
